当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

linux 云服务,Linux云服务器深度指南,从入门到精通的全方位教程

linux 云服务,Linux云服务器深度指南,从入门到精通的全方位教程

Linux云服务深度指南,涵盖从入门到精通的全方位教程,助您掌握Linux云服务器操作。...

Linux云服务深度指南,涵盖从入门到精通的全方位教程,助您掌握linux云服务器操作。

随着云计算技术的飞速发展,Linux云服务器已成为众多企业及个人用户的首选,本文将从Linux云服务器的概念、搭建、配置、优化、安全等方面进行详细介绍,旨在帮助读者从入门到精通,轻松驾驭Linux云服务器。

Linux云服务器概述

1、什么是Linux云服务器?

Linux云服务器是指基于Linux操作系统,通过云计算技术构建的服务器,它具有高度的可扩展性、高可靠性、易管理性等特点,适用于各种场景,如网站、游戏、数据库等。

2、Linux云服务器的优势

(1)高可靠性:云计算技术确保了服务器的稳定运行,降低了故障率。

linux 云服务,Linux云服务器深度指南,从入门到精通的全方位教程

(2)可扩展性:根据业务需求,可以随时增加或减少服务器资源。

(3)易管理性:通过云管理平台,用户可以方便地管理服务器资源。

(4)成本效益:相比于传统服务器,Linux云服务器具有更高的性价比。

Linux云服务器搭建

1、选择云服务提供商

目前市场上主流的云服务提供商有阿里云、腾讯云、华为云等,选择云服务提供商时,需考虑价格、性能、稳定性、技术支持等因素。

2、创建云服务器实例

以阿里云为例,登录阿里云官网,进入云服务器ECS控制台,点击“创建实例”,在创建实例页面,选择操作系统(Linux)、地域、网络、公网IP等配置,然后点击“购买”。

3、获取云服务器公网IP

云服务器创建完成后,在控制台中可以查看公网IP地址,通过SSH工具,如Xshell、PuTTY等,连接到云服务器。

4、设置SSH免密登录

(1)在本地电脑生成SSH密钥对:ssh-keygen -t rsa

(2)将公钥复制到云服务器:ssh-copy-id -i ~/.ssh/id_rsa.pub root@公网IP

(3)登录云服务器:ssh root@公网IP

Linux云服务器配置

1、更新系统

linux 云服务,Linux云服务器深度指南,从入门到精通的全方位教程

在云服务器上执行以下命令,更新系统软件包:

sudo apt-get update
sudo apt-get upgrade

2、安装软件

根据业务需求,安装相应的软件,以下以安装Apache和MySQL为例:

sudo apt-get install apache2
sudo apt-get install mysql-server

3、配置Apache和MySQL

(1)配置Apache:

编辑/etc/apache2/apache2.conf文件,取消注释以下行:

ServerName 公网IP

重启Apache服务:

sudo systemctl restart apache2

(2)配置MySQL:

设置root用户密码:

sudo mysql_secure_installation

创建数据库和用户:

sudo mysql -u root -p
CREATE DATABASE mydatabase;
CREATE USER 'user'@'%' IDENTIFIED BY 'password';
GRANT ALL PRIVILEGES ON mydatabase.* TO 'user'@'%';
FLUSH PRIVILEGES;

Linux云服务器优化

1、硬件优化

(1)选择合适的云服务器实例规格,以满足业务需求。

(2)定期清理磁盘空间,释放冗余资源。

2、软件优化

linux 云服务,Linux云服务器深度指南,从入门到精通的全方位教程

(1)关闭不必要的系统服务。

(2)优化系统配置,如调整内核参数、调整MySQL配置等。

(3)使用缓存技术,如Redis、Memcached等,提高系统性能。

Linux云服务器安全

1、设置防火墙规则

(1)关闭默认开放的所有端口。

(2)只允许必要的端口开放,如SSH、HTTP、HTTPS等。

2、设置SSH密码登录

(1)修改SSH配置文件/etc/ssh/sshd_config,取消注释以下行:

PasswordAuthentication yes
PermitRootLogin no

(2)重启SSH服务:

sudo systemctl restart ssh

3、安装安全软件

(1)安装Fail2Ban,防止暴力破解。

(2)安装ClamAV,检测病毒。

本文从Linux云服务器的概念、搭建、配置、优化、安全等方面进行了详细介绍,通过学习本文,读者可以掌握Linux云服务器的基本操作,为后续业务拓展打下坚实基础,在实际应用中,还需不断学习新技术、新工具,提高自己的技能水平。

黑狐家游戏

发表评论

最新文章